Warning Signs You Need AC Unit Water Removal

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ent long-term health risks. If you notice any of the following signs, don’t hesitate to call us for help.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ant smells can show moisture buildup in your walls or floors. Our team will investigate and provide a clear explanation of the cause and solution.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Don’t ignore uneven or warped flooring, as it can be a sign of underlying water damage. We’ll assess the situation and recommend the best course of action.

Visible Water Stains or Leaks

Water stains or leaks are clear indicators of water damage. Our team will identify the source of the leak and provide a plan to restore your property.

Water Damage in Electrical Outlets or Switches

Don’t take chances with water-logged electrical parts. Our team will safely disconnect and replace damaged electrical parts to prevent further damage.

Water Damage in Insulation or Drywall

Water-soaked insulation or drywall can compromise your property’s structural integrity.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the best course of action for repair or replacement.

Water Damage in HVAC Systems

Water-logged HVAC systems can lead to costly repairs or even replacement. Our team will inspect and address any damage to ensure your system runs efficiently and safely.

AC Unit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single room Yes Yes Quick response and DIY equipment may be enough for small leaks.
Large flood in multiple rooms No Yes Large floods need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Water damage behind walls or floors No Yes Hidden water damage needs professional inspection and restoration to prevent long-term health risks.
Water damage in electrical parts No Yes Water-logged electrical parts pose a significant safety risk and need professional attention.
Water damage in insulation or drywall No Yes Water-soaked insulation or drywall can compromise your property’s structural integrity and need professional repair or replacement.
Water damage in HVAC systems No Yes Water-logged HVAC systems can lead to costly repairs or even replacement and need professional inspection and restoration.

In most cases, it’s recommended to call a professional for AC unit water removal, especially when dealing with large floods, hidden water damage, or electrical parts. Our team has the expertise, equipment, and experience to handle complex water damage restoration projects.

AC Unit Water Removal Cost in Orem, UT

The cost of AC unit water removal in Orem, UT, var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are estimates, not guarantees, and will be finalized after an on-site assessment.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response and Assessment $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Water Extraction and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water, complexity of extraction, and number of rooms affected.
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Type and quantity of cleaning products used, complexity of cleaning, and number of surfaces affected.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Number of dehumidifiers used, duration of drying process, and local humidity levels.
Final Inspection and Restoration $500 – $2,000 Complexity of repairs, number of materials needed, and labor costs.
Inspection and Repair of Electrical Parts $1,000 – $3,000 Severity of damage, complexity of repair, and number of parts affected.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available upon request.
